The rich have increased by 28% in 10 years in Morocco

A recent report revealed that the number of wealthy people is increasing in Morocco. The kingdom is present among the top 5 countries with the most wealth on the African continent.

In a study published by Henley and Partners, Morocco is one of the countries with the most wealthy countries alongside South Africa, Egypt, Nigeria and Kenya. They represent 56% of the rich in Africa.

Between 2012 and 2022, the number of rich in Morocco in particular has increased by 28%. Currently, the kingdom has more than 5,800 people whose wealth exceeds $1 million, 28 people whose wealth exceeds $100 million, and finally 4 people whose wealth exceeds $1 billion.

The list of richest African countries was led by South Africa, with 37,800 people whose wealth exceeds one million dollars, then Egypt with 16,000 people, Nigeria with 9,800 people, then Kenya with 7,700 people.

The term wealth refers to an individual’s net assets in property, cash, and stocks. The report estimates total wealth invested in the continent at $2.4 trillion, with around 138,000 people with wealth over $1 million, 328 people with wealth over $100 million and 23 with wealth over $1 billion. billion, expecting the number of millionaires on the continent to increase by 42% over the next decade.

On the other hand, the same report indicates that the Moroccan passport ranks 14th at the African level, as it allows travel to 65 countries without a visa, also indicating that Marrakech is among the tourist cities that attract the rich from Africa.
